The Role of Peptides in Skin Rejuvenation
Peptides are short chains of amino acids that play a crucial role in skin rejuvenation. They work by stimulating collagen production, which helps to improve skin elasticity and firmness. In the context of ocular health, peptides can help to re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, while also improving the overall texture and tone of the skin. Caffeine: A Stimulating Ingredient
Caffeine is a popular ingredient in many eye creams due to its ability to reduce puffiness and dark circles. It works by constricting blood vessels and improving circulation, which helps to reduce the appearance of swollen skin. However, excessive use of caffeine can lead to side effects such as dryness, irritation, and increased sensitivity.
Antioxidant Synergy: A Powerful Duo
Alpha lipoic acid and vitamin C are two antioxidants that work synergistically to combat oxidative stress and promote skin health. Alpha lipoic acid helps to neutralize free radicals and protect against environmental damage, while vitamin C enhances collagen production and improves skin elasticity. This combination is particularly effective in eye creams, as it addresses concerns such as fine lines, wrinkles, and discoloration.

Moisturizing Ingredients: A Comparison
When it comes to moisturizing the eye area, glycerin, panthenol, and ceramides are popular ingredients used in eye creams. Glycerin helps to lock in moisture and soothe dry skin, while panthenol nourishes and hydrates the skin. Ceramides, on the other hand, repair and restore the skin’s natural barrier function. Each of these ingredients has its own unique benefits, and the best eye cream will often combine multiple moisturizing agents for optimal results.
